Digital Modernization And Digital Transformation Pdf Modernization is a continuous and open ended process. historically, the span of time over which it has occurred must be measured in centuries, although there are examples of accelerated modernization. in either case, modernization is not a once and for all time achievement. Modernization theory or modernisation theory holds that as societies become more economically modernized, wealthier and more educated, their political institutions become increasingly liberal democratic and rationalist. Business Transformation Through Digital Modernization Pdf The modernization theory outlines the ways in which a premodern society becomes modern. through five stages, it hypothesizes how capitalistic drives and new technology can make a traditional society into a modern one. Modernization theory explains how societies develop and become modern. its focus on technology and economic progress has been influential in shaping how policymakers think about and work towards development. Modernization industrialization, urbanization, globalization: modernity must be understood, in part at least, against the background of what went before. industrial society emerged only patchily and unevenly out of agrarian society, a system that had endured for 5,000 years. Modernization theory is a sociological approach that seeks to understand the process of modernization, and the variables conducive to the development of societies (knöbl, 2003).

In short, modernization involves a process of secularization; that is, it systematically challenges religious institutions, beliefs, and practices, substituting for them those of reason and science. this process was first observable in christian europe toward the end of the 17th century. For the first time, moralists and philosophers began to conceive of the possibility that the modern world might come to be the equal and even the superior of the ancient world of greece and rome. the idea of progress, and with it that of modernism, was born.
